Subject: [PATCH] cciss: return 0 from driver probe function on success, not 1

A return value of 1 is interpreted as an error

Signed-off-by: Stephen M. Cameron <scameron@beardog.cce.hp.com>
---
 drivers/block/cciss.c |    2 +-
 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/block/cciss.c b/drivers/block/cciss.c
index edfa251..0c004ac 100644
--- a/drivers/block/cciss.c
+++ b/drivers/block/cciss.c
@@ -5183,7 +5183,7 @@ reinit_after_soft_reset:
 	rebuild_lun_table(h, 1, 0);
 	cciss_engage_scsi(h);
 	h->busy_initializing = 0;
-	return 1;
+	return 0;
 
 clean4:
 	cciss_free_cmd_pool(h);
